F-street is the new class you'd run, it's basically what you ran in RTR, except that was F-Stock (where race tires were legal) minus the race tires and with an index to match up with other street tire cars.

BUT, you can't have lowering springs in Street or Stock categories. You can have sticker tires, and you can have damping adjustable shocks, but have to run stock springs, at stock height, no coil-overs, etc. You can change one sway bar, front or back but not both. You can't do a lot else, if you do it's off to STU or ESP, or SM for you.
